  1. // SPDX-FileCopyrightText: Copyright The Miniflux Authors. All rights reserved.
  2. // SPDX-License-Identifier: Apache-2.0
  3. package rss // import "miniflux.app/v2/internal/reader/rss"
  4. import (
  5. "html"
  6. "log/slog"
  7. "path"
  8. "strconv"
  9. "strings"
  10. "time"
  11. "miniflux.app/v2/internal/crypto"
  12. "miniflux.app/v2/internal/model"
  13. "miniflux.app/v2/internal/reader/date"
  14. "miniflux.app/v2/internal/reader/sanitizer"
  15. "miniflux.app/v2/internal/urllib"
  16. )
  17. type RSSAdapter struct {
  18. rss *RSS
  19. }
  20. func NewRSSAdapter(rss *RSS) *RSSAdapter {
  21. return &RSSAdapter{rss}
  22. }
  23. func (r *RSSAdapter) BuildFeed(baseURL string) *model.Feed {
  24. feed := &model.Feed{
  25. Title: html.UnescapeString(strings.TrimSpace(r.rss.Channel.Title)),
  26. FeedURL: strings.TrimSpace(baseURL),
  27. SiteURL: strings.TrimSpace(r.rss.Channel.Link),
  28. Description: strings.TrimSpace(r.rss.Channel.Description),
  29. }
  30. // Ensure the Site URL is absolute.
  31. if siteURL, err := urllib.AbsoluteURL(baseURL, feed.SiteURL); err == nil {
  32. feed.SiteURL = siteURL
  33. }
  34. // Try to find the feed URL from the Atom links.
  35. for _, atomLink := range r.rss.Channel.Links {
  36. atomLinkHref := strings.TrimSpace(atomLink.Href)
  37. if atomLinkHref != "" && atomLink.Rel == "self" {
  38. if absoluteFeedURL, err := urllib.AbsoluteURL(feed.FeedURL, atomLinkHref); err == nil {
  39. feed.FeedURL = absoluteFeedURL
  40. break
  41. }
  42. }
  43. }
  44. // Fallback to the site URL if the title is empty.
  45. if feed.Title == "" {
  46. feed.Title = feed.SiteURL
  47. }
  48. // Get TTL if defined.
  49. if r.rss.Channel.TTL != "" {
  50. if ttl, err := strconv.Atoi(r.rss.Channel.TTL); err == nil {
  51. feed.TTL = ttl
  52. }
  53. }
  54. // Get the feed icon URL if defined.
  55. if r.rss.Channel.Image != nil {
  56. if absoluteIconURL, err := urllib.AbsoluteURL(feed.SiteURL, r.rss.Channel.Image.URL); err == nil {
  57. feed.IconURL = absoluteIconURL
  58. }
  59. }
  60. for _, item := range r.rss.Channel.Items {
  61. entry := model.NewEntry()
  62. entry.Date = findEntryDate(&item)
  63. entry.Content = findEntryContent(&item)
  64. entry.Enclosures = findEntryEnclosures(&item, feed.SiteURL)
  65. // Populate the entry URL.
  66. entryURL := findEntryURL(&item)
  67. if entryURL == "" {
  68. entry.URL = feed.SiteURL
  69. } else {
  70. if absoluteEntryURL, err := urllib.AbsoluteURL(feed.SiteURL, entryURL); err == nil {
  71. entry.URL = absoluteEntryURL
  72. } else {
  73. entry.URL = entryURL
  74. }
  75. }
  76. // Populate the entry title.
  77. entry.Title = findEntryTitle(&item)
  78. if entry.Title == "" {
  79. entry.Title = sanitizer.TruncateHTML(entry.Content, 100)
  80. if entry.Title == "" {
  81. entry.Title = entry.URL
  82. }
  83. }
  84. entry.Author = findEntryAuthor(&item)
  85. if entry.Author == "" {
  86. entry.Author = findFeedAuthor(&r.rss.Channel)
  87. }
  88. // Generate the entry hash.
  89. switch {
  90. case item.GUID.Data != "":
  91. entry.Hash = crypto.Hash(item.GUID.Data)
  92. case entryURL != "":
  93. entry.Hash = crypto.Hash(entryURL)
  94. default:
  95. entry.Hash = crypto.Hash(entry.Title + entry.Content)
  96. }
  97. // Find CommentsURL if defined.
  98. if absoluteCommentsURL := strings.TrimSpace(item.CommentsURL); absoluteCommentsURL != "" && urllib.IsAbsoluteURL(absoluteCommentsURL) {
  99. entry.CommentsURL = absoluteCommentsURL
  100. }
  101. // Set podcast listening time.
  102. if item.ItunesDuration != "" {
  103. if duration, err := getDurationInMinutes(item.ItunesDuration); err == nil {
  104. entry.ReadingTime = duration
  105. }
  106. }
  107. // Populate entry categories.
  108. for _, tag := range item.Categories {
  109. if tag != "" {
  110. entry.Tags = append(entry.Tags, tag)
  111. }
  112. }
  113. for _, tag := range item.MediaCategories.Labels() {
  114. if tag != "" {
  115. entry.Tags = append(entry.Tags, tag)
  116. }
  117. }
  118. if len(entry.Tags) == 0 {
  119. for _, tag := range r.rss.Channel.Categories {
  120. if tag != "" {
  121. entry.Tags = append(entry.Tags, tag)
  122. }
  123. }
  124. for _, tag := range r.rss.Channel.GetItunesCategories() {
  125. if tag != "" {
  126. entry.Tags = append(entry.Tags, tag)
  127. }
  128. }
  129. if r.rss.Channel.GooglePlayCategory.Text != "" {
  130. entry.Tags = append(entry.Tags, r.rss.Channel.GooglePlayCategory.Text)
  131. }
  132. }
  133. feed.Entries = append(feed.Entries, entry)
  134. }
  135. return feed
  136. }
  137. func findFeedAuthor(rssChannel *RSSChannel) string {
  138. var author string
  139. switch {
  140. case rssChannel.ItunesAuthor != "":
  141. author = rssChannel.ItunesAuthor
  142. case rssChannel.GooglePlayAuthor != "":
  143. author = rssChannel.GooglePlayAuthor
  144. case rssChannel.ItunesOwner.String() != "":
  145. author = rssChannel.ItunesOwner.String()
  146. case rssChannel.ManagingEditor != "":
  147. author = rssChannel.ManagingEditor
  148. case rssChannel.Webmaster != "":
  149. author = rssChannel.Webmaster
  150. }
  151. return sanitizer.StripTags(strings.TrimSpace(author))
  152. }
  153. func findEntryTitle(rssItem *RSSItem) string {
  154. title := rssItem.Title.Content
  155. if rssItem.DublinCoreTitle != "" {
  156. title = rssItem.DublinCoreTitle
  157. }
  158. return html.UnescapeString(html.UnescapeString(strings.TrimSpace(title)))
  159. }
  160. func findEntryURL(rssItem *RSSItem) string {
  161. for _, link := range []string{rssItem.FeedBurnerLink, rssItem.Link} {
  162. if link != "" {
  163. return strings.TrimSpace(link)
  164. }
  165. }
  166. for _, atomLink := range rssItem.Links {
  167. if atomLink.Href != "" && (strings.EqualFold(atomLink.Rel, "alternate") || atomLink.Rel == "") {
  168. return strings.TrimSpace(atomLink.Href)
  169. }
  170. }
  171. // Specs: https://cyber.harvard.edu/rss/rss.html#ltguidgtSubelementOfLtitemgt
  172. // isPermaLink is optional, its default value is true.
  173. // If its value is false, the guid may not be assumed to be a url, or a url to anything in particular.
  174. if rssItem.GUID.IsPermaLink == "true" || rssItem.GUID.IsPermaLink == "" {
  175. return strings.TrimSpace(rssItem.GUID.Data)
  176. }
  177. return ""
  178. }
  179. func findEntryContent(rssItem *RSSItem) string {
  180. for _, value := range []string{
  181. rssItem.DublinCoreContent,
  182. rssItem.Description,
  183. rssItem.GooglePlayDescription,
  184. rssItem.ItunesSummary,
  185. rssItem.ItunesSubtitle,
  186. } {
  187. if value != "" {
  188. return value
  189. }
  190. }
  191. return ""
  192. }
  193. func findEntryDate(rssItem *RSSItem) time.Time {
  194. value := rssItem.PubDate
  195. if rssItem.DublinCoreDate != "" {
  196. value = rssItem.DublinCoreDate
  197. }
  198. if value != "" {
  199. result, err := date.Parse(value)
  200. if err != nil {
  201. slog.Debug("Unable to parse date from RSS feed",
  202. slog.String("date", value),
  203. slog.String("guid", rssItem.GUID.Data),
  204. slog.Any("error", err),
  205. )
  206. return time.Now()
  207. }
  208. return result
  209. }
  210. return time.Now()
  211. }
  212. func findEntryAuthor(rssItem *RSSItem) string {
  213. var author string
  214. switch {
  215. case rssItem.GooglePlayAuthor != "":
  216. author = rssItem.GooglePlayAuthor
  217. case rssItem.ItunesAuthor != "":
  218. author = rssItem.ItunesAuthor
  219. case rssItem.DublinCoreCreator != "":
  220. author = rssItem.DublinCoreCreator
  221. case rssItem.PersonName() != "":
  222. author = rssItem.PersonName()
  223. case strings.Contains(rssItem.Author.Inner, "<![CDATA["):
  224. author = rssItem.Author.Data
  225. default:
  226. author = rssItem.Author.Inner
  227. }
  228. return strings.TrimSpace(sanitizer.StripTags(author))
  229. }
  230. func findEntryEnclosures(rssItem *RSSItem, siteURL string) model.EnclosureList {
  231. enclosures := make(model.EnclosureList, 0)
  232. duplicates := make(map[string]bool)
  233. for _, mediaThumbnail := range rssItem.AllMediaThumbnails() {
  234. mediaURL := strings.TrimSpace(mediaThumbnail.URL)
  235. if mediaURL == "" {
  236. continue
  237. }
  238. if _, found := duplicates[mediaURL]; !found {
  239. if mediaAbsoluteURL, err := urllib.AbsoluteURL(siteURL, mediaURL); err != nil {
  240. slog.Debug("Unable to build absolute URL for media thumbnail",
  241. slog.String("url", mediaThumbnail.URL),
  242. slog.String("site_url", siteURL),
  243. slog.Any("error", err),
  244. )
  245. } else {
  246. duplicates[mediaAbsoluteURL] = true
  247. enclosures = append(enclosures, &model.Enclosure{
  248. URL: mediaAbsoluteURL,
  249. MimeType: mediaThumbnail.MimeType(),
  250. Size: mediaThumbnail.Size(),
  251. })
  252. }
  253. }
  254. }
  255. for _, enclosure := range rssItem.Enclosures {
  256. enclosureURL := enclosure.URL
  257. if rssItem.FeedBurnerEnclosureLink != "" {
  258. filename := path.Base(rssItem.FeedBurnerEnclosureLink)
  259. if strings.HasSuffix(enclosureURL, filename) {
  260. enclosureURL = rssItem.FeedBurnerEnclosureLink
  261. }
  262. }
  263. enclosureURL = strings.TrimSpace(enclosureURL)
  264. if enclosureURL == "" {
  265. continue
  266. }
  267. if absoluteEnclosureURL, err := urllib.AbsoluteURL(siteURL, enclosureURL); err == nil {
  268. enclosureURL = absoluteEnclosureURL
  269. }
  270. if _, found := duplicates[enclosureURL]; !found {
  271. duplicates[enclosureURL] = true
  272. enclosures = append(enclosures, &model.Enclosure{
  273. URL: enclosureURL,
  274. MimeType: enclosure.Type,
  275. Size: enclosure.Size(),
  276. })
  277. }
  278. }
  279. for _, mediaContent := range rssItem.AllMediaContents() {
  280. mediaURL := strings.TrimSpace(mediaContent.URL)
  281. if mediaURL == "" {
  282. continue
  283. }
  284. if _, found := duplicates[mediaURL]; !found {
  285. mediaURL := strings.TrimSpace(mediaContent.URL)
  286. if mediaAbsoluteURL, err := urllib.AbsoluteURL(siteURL, mediaURL); err != nil {
  287. slog.Debug("Unable to build absolute URL for media content",
  288. slog.String("url", mediaContent.URL),
  289. slog.String("site_url", siteURL),
  290. slog.Any("error", err),
  291. )
  292. } else {
  293. duplicates[mediaAbsoluteURL] = true
  294. enclosures = append(enclosures, &model.Enclosure{
  295. URL: mediaAbsoluteURL,
  296. MimeType: mediaContent.MimeType(),
  297. Size: mediaContent.Size(),
  298. })
  299. }
  300. }
  301. }
  302. for _, mediaPeerLink := range rssItem.AllMediaPeerLinks() {
  303. mediaURL := strings.TrimSpace(mediaPeerLink.URL)
  304. if mediaURL == "" {
  305. continue
  306. }
  307. if _, found := duplicates[mediaURL]; !found {
  308. mediaURL := strings.TrimSpace(mediaPeerLink.URL)
  309. if mediaAbsoluteURL, err := urllib.AbsoluteURL(siteURL, mediaURL); err != nil {
  310. slog.Debug("Unable to build absolute URL for media peer link",
  311. slog.String("url", mediaPeerLink.URL),
  312. slog.String("site_url", siteURL),
  313. slog.Any("error", err),
  314. )
  315. } else {
  316. duplicates[mediaAbsoluteURL] = true
  317. enclosures = append(enclosures, &model.Enclosure{
  318. URL: mediaAbsoluteURL,
  319. MimeType: mediaPeerLink.MimeType(),
  320. Size: mediaPeerLink.Size(),
  321. })
  322. }
  323. }
  324. }
  325. return enclosures
